In response to big business, working class organized labor unions. Before the civil war, labor unions were short lived, and local. Workers had a spiritual dislocation because of the work place. For instance, assembly line workers are only one in a crowd of other assembly line workers. The workers didn"t identify or care about the product they were making. Organizers for labor unions wanted to bargain more effectively. Immigrant competition brought a big pool of workers for replacements, which would limit union power. Women are entering the workforce in increasing numbers. Women don"t join unions, and neither do most males. Now that homestead act is closed, people feel trapped in the working man"s life. They think that union workers are assaulting private property. Union organizers are seen as the scum of the earth. The three main labor unions: knights of labor, national labor union, and american.
